Deacon Everton Clarke of the Sons of God Apostolic Church received the cross in the second of 14 Stations of the Cross.
The activity formed part of the church’s commemoration of Good Friday.  
The object of the Stations is to help the faithful to make a spiritual pilgrimage of prayer through meditating upon the chief scenes of Christ’s sufferings and death.
It is often performed in a spirit of reparation for the sufferings and insults that Jesus endured during His Passion.
Here, Deacon Clarke offering words of prayer along Baxters Road, before moving on along the route that proceeded across Bridgetown.
